With the supernatural series, Divya-Drishti ending on Sunday, April 8, Star Life will be allocating two new shows – Evil Affairs and Beyond Love to the timeslot.
These series will be split within a 1 hour timeslot therefore increasing primetime on the channel from 13 to 15 series.
While Evil Affairs takes up the 22:00 timeslot, Beyond Love takes the 22:30 timeslot.
Evil Affairs (Shaitani Rasmein) centered around Nikki, an orphan who discovers love in Piyush, the prince of the esteemed Gehlot family of Bhurangarh.
The story unfolds as they embark on the path to matrimony, blissfully unaware of the ominous secrets harboured by Piyush’s family.
It starred Shefali Jariwala as Kapalika, Naqiyah Haji as Nikki, Vibhav Roy as Piyush, Surbhi Shukla as Arohi and Nikita Sharma as Saudamini.
Beyond Love (Aashiqana) revolves around Yashwardhan Chauhan, a police officer who is haunted by the deaths of close family members, and Chikki Sharma, who aspires to be a police officer like her father but fails the entrance exams.
It starred Zayn Ibad Khan as A.C.P. Yashvardhan Chauhan, Khushi Dubey as Chikki Chauhan, Harshita Shukla as Mausi, Anurag Vyas as Shyam and Sneha Chauhan as Payal.
